ホームページ  >  記事  >  データベース  >  oracle sysのパスワード変更

oracle sysのパスワード変更

WBOY
WBOYオリジナル
2023-05-07 22:17:066425ブラウズ

Oracle は広く使用されているデータベース管理システムです。データベース管理者 (DBA) は、多くの場合、Oracle システムの管理と保守を行う必要があります。非常に基本的な操作の一つにOracleのsysユーザーのパスワード変更がありますが、今回はこれをテーマにOracleのsysユーザーのパスワードを変更する方法を紹介します。

sys ユーザーは、Oracle データベースのデフォルトの管理者アカウントです。データベースが作成されると、通常、sys と system という 2 人のユーザーが作成されます。このうちsysユーザーはOralceデータベースの最高権限を持ち、様々なデータベースを管理・操作することができます。したがって、sys ユーザーのパスワードのセキュリティを確保することが重要です。

次に、Oracle で sys ユーザーのパスワードを変更する方法を紹介します。

  1. sys ユーザーが現在データベースにログインしている場合は、次の SQL ステートメントを使用できます。
alter user sys identified by 新密码;

これは最も簡単な方法です。データベースにログインしている場合は、上記のコマンドを使用して sys ユーザーのパスワードをすぐに変更できます。パスワードを変更した後は、新しいパスワードで再度ログインする必要があります。

  1. sys ユーザーのパスワードがない場合は、まず別の管理者ユーザーとしてログインし、次に次のコマンドを使用して sysdba としてログインする必要があります。
    sqlplus / as sysdba
  2. In コマンドを入力すると、管理者ユーザーのパスワードの入力を求められますので、入力後、sysdba モードに入ることができます。

sysdba モードに入った後、次の SQL ステートメントを使用して sys ユーザーのパスワードを変更できます:
  1. alter user sys identified by 新密码;
  2. パスワードの変更後は、次のステートメントを使用する必要があります Exit sysdba mode:
exit;

このメソッドは sys ユーザーのパスワードのみを変更することに注意してください。初めてパスワードを変更する場合、またはすべてのユーザーのパスワードを更新する場合は、管理者アカウントの場合は、上記の操作を実行する必要があります。 操作後、次のステートメントを使用して、sys、system、sysman、およびその他のユーザーのパスワードが一致しているかどうかを確認します。

select username, account_status from dba_users where username in ('SYS', 'SYSTEM', 'SYSMAN');

ユーザーのパスワードが他のユーザーと一致しない場合の場合、ユーザーのパスワードを個別に変更する必要があります。

概要:

Oracle で sys ユーザーのパスワードを変更するのは実際には非常に簡単で、alter user ステートメントを使用して sysdba としてログインするだけです。ただし、パスワードを変更する場合は、管理者アカウントのセキュリティの確保に注意するとともに、各管理者アカウントのパスワードの整合性にも注意する必要があります。この記事が Oracle データベース管理のお役に立てれば幸いです。

以上がoracle sysのパスワード変更の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。